Personal data Elizabeth unknown 

Source 1
  • She was born about 1580 in England.
  • Profession: After death of her first husband, surname Patterson, she married Peter Eaton as her second spouse.
  • Resident: Dover, Kent, England.
  • She died on January 8, 1632 in Dover, Kent, England.
  • She is buried on January 8, 1631.

    Fout Attention: Buried (January 8, 1631) before death (January 8, 1632).


Household of Elizabeth unknown

She is married to Peter Eaton, of Staples & Dover.

They got married on January 28, 1603 at Dover, Kent, England.
